Aug 10, 1995 · Our enforcement policy with regard to the paragraph 1910.269(l)(6) apparel standard follows. Paragraph 1910.269(l)(6)(i) - Citations shall be issued when CSHO's determine that employees wear exposed conductive articles when performing work within reaching distance of exposed, energized parts, unless they have rendered such articles of apparel ...

Mar 17, 1993 · As you may be aware, OSHA prohibits, under 1910.333 (c) (8), Safety-Related Work Practices standard, the wearing of conductive articles of jewelry and clothing which might contact exposed energized parts, unless the articles, if worn, are rendered nonconductive by insulating means.
